Foote named employee of the month

CHAMBERSBURG – The Franklin County Commissioners presented the January 2022 Employee of the Month award to Christopher Foote. Foote has been employed with Franklin County since December 2016 and currently serves as a booking officer/correctional officer with the Franklin County Jail.

January’s Employee of the Month recipient was determined by the Special Thanks and Recognition Committee, which received a total of 14 nominations for the January award, including four for Foote.

When nominating a coworker, employees are asked to share a specific event or circumstance that makes an individual deserving of Employee of the Month. Foote’s nominations cited his professionalism, his natural ability to handle emergencies, and his positive attitude.

“Over the last few years, Officer Foote has continuously improved and has taken on additional duties…to improve himself within the facility, and his value increases each and every day,” said one nomination form. “Officer Foote keeps a professional, positive attitude and always has a smile on his face. He’s quiet and calm, but demands attention when needed. He continuously works an additional 15-20 hours each week, an on-going scenario for months. Even though he works these additional hours, he stays positive and alert.”

Other nominations referenced how Foote handled four incidents, including two medical emergencies, during one shift when he was the only officer working a two-person post.

“If Officer Foote had not been paying as close attention as he was, or if he had not stepped in when he did, both inmates could have lost their lives,” noted one coworker.

Another nomination noted that, “Officer Foote did a great job maintaining the safety of the inmates involved. He displays unique situational awareness, a keen sense of natural response to an emergency situation, and thorough job knowledge.”

Foote’s outstanding characteristics are attributes that have not gone unnoticed by his
peers. The nomination form describes him as dedicated, efficient, conscientious, someone who puts others before himself and someone who is willing to help without complaining.

The Franklin County Commissioners are grateful to Foote as he exudes a high standard of customer service, excellence and respect to the employees and residents of Franklin County.
